How many calories in Beef

The number of calories in beef are listed below per 100 grams (3.5 oz). Portion sizes can vary greatly between products purchased and different individuals, therefore the list of beef calories should be used to compare the calorie content of each beef type.

Beef calories can be high due to high fat and protein content. To keep the calories in beef low try selecting the leanest portions when buying. It may also be a good idea to stew lean pieces of beef with vegetables and boiled potatoes to create a low calorie dish, rather than serving with higher calorie roast / fried potatoes and gravy or sauces.

Beef Calories Fat
Brisket (boiled) 330 24g
Fillet Steak (grilled) 210 20g
Forerib (roast) 358 30g
Minced (stewed) 235 16g
Rump Steak (grilled) 220 13g
Rump Steak (fried) 250 15g
Silverside (boiled) 240 14g
Sirloin (roast) 280 20g
Stewing Steak 225 12g
Topside (roast) 219 11g
 Values correct at time of testing, values for calories in beef will vary between different portion sizes!
